- PR -

JavaScriptでのメッセージ表示で文字化け

投稿者投稿内容
べる
ぬし
会議室デビュー日: 2003/09/20
投稿数: 1093
投稿日時: 2006-06-02 14:24
引用:
解決策Aaspx ファイルの外部ファイルの指定にcharsetを追加する。
<script language=javascript src="外部ファイル名" charset="Shift-JIS">
,,,,,,,charsetの下線にエラーの表示がでましたが、実行してみたところ
       正常動作しました。

エンコードが異なる場合、私はいまではこれが正しいかなと思っています。
(特に理由がない限りjsファイルのエンコードをあわせちゃいますが。)

script要素のcharset属性はちゃんとあるようですし。
http://www.w3.org/TR/REC-html40/interact/scripts.html#h-18.2.1
      
引用:
この方法で、.net framework2.0 だったり、ClientマシンのVersion依存なく動くと
いいな、なんて思ったりしてます。

ブラウザがちゃんと解釈するかどうかですね、きっと。

スキルアップ/キャリアアップ(JOB@IT)